win7命令行删除文件(Win7 CMD删文件)
作者:路由通
|

发布时间:2025-05-09 07:19:01
标签:
在Windows 7操作系统中,命令行删除文件是高效管理文件系统的重要手段,尤其在批量操作、自动化脚本或远程管理场景中具有不可替代的作用。与传统图形界面删除相比,命令行删除支持更精细的参数控制(如递归删除、强制删除、隐藏文件处理等),但同时

在Windows 7操作系统中,命令行删除文件是高效管理文件系统的重要手段,尤其在批量操作、自动化脚本或远程管理场景中具有不可替代的作用。与传统图形界面删除相比,命令行删除支持更精细的参数控制(如递归删除、强制删除、隐藏文件处理等),但同时也存在更高的操作风险。本文将从技术原理、命令差异、权限机制等八个维度展开分析,并通过对比表格直观呈现不同命令的行为特征。
一、基础命令与语法结构
1. 核心命令解析
Windows 7提供两种主要命令行删除工具:
del
和rmdir
(或rd
)。其中del
用于删除文件,rmdir
用于删除空目录,而del /s
组合可递归删除目录及其中所有文件。 命令类型 | 适用对象 | 是否支持递归 | 是否需要空目录 |
---|---|---|---|
del | 文件/非空目录(需/s) | 需加/s参数 | 否 |
rmdir | 空目录 | 否 | 是 |
del .
会删除当前目录下所有文件,但保留子目录结构;而del /s .
则会清空当前目录及所有子目录。二、关键参数与功能扩展
2. 参数作用深度对比
参数 | 作用范围 | 典型应用场景 |
---|---|---|
/p | 逐文件确认 | 防止误删重要文件 |
/q | 静默模式 | 批量脚本自动化 |
/f | 强制删除只读文件 | 绕过系统保护属性 |
del /f /q C:Test.tmp
会静默强制删除所有临时文件,而del /p .log
则会逐个询问是否删除日志文件。三、权限机制与限制突破
3. 权限层级与解决方案
限制类型 | 表现特征 | 解决策略 |
---|---|---|
普通用户权限 | 拒绝访问系统目录 | 使用runas 提权 |
文件锁定状态 | 无法删除被进程占用的文件 | 结合taskkill 终止进程 |
隐藏/系统文件 | 默认不显示 | 添加/a 参数或修改属性 |
runas "cmd /c del C:WindowsSystem32test.dll"
以管理员身份执行。四、特殊文件类型处理
4. 异常文件删除策略
文件类型 | 常规命令表现 | 增强方案 |
---|---|---|
加密EFS文件 | 拒绝访问(需解密) | 暂存解密后删除 |
压缩存储文件 | 提示文件已损坏 | 先解压或强制覆盖 |
网络映射驱动器 | 权限依赖网络策略 | 映射本地符号链接 |
compact /u file.zip
解除压缩后再删除。五、计划任务与自动化脚本
5. 定时删除实现方法
通过任务计划程序结合命令行,可实现周期性清理。例如:- 创建批处理文件:
del /s /q "C:Temp"
- 配置触发器:每天凌晨2点执行
- 设置动作:启动程序选择
cmd.exe
,参数为/c "C:cleanup.bat"
del /s /q "C:Temp" /exclusions:".tmp"
实现(需第三方工具支持)。六、日志记录与审计追踪
6. 操作日志生成方案
原生命令行不直接支持日志记录,但可通过重定向或第三方工具实现:方法 | 命令示例 | 日志内容 |
---|---|---|
标准输出重定向 | del /s /q C:Logs.txt > delete.log | 仅记录成功删除的文件列表 |
启用回显(/echo) | del /s /q C:Logs.txt & echo %date% %time% >> delete.log | 追加时间戳到日志 |
PowerShell Start-Transcript
捕获完整会话。七、与其他命令的组合应用
7. 复合操作场景
命令行删除常与其他指令配合完成复杂任务:dir /b | del
:删除当前目录所有文件(等效于del
)move failed.log C:Backup & del failed.log
:备份后删除错误日志forfiles -m .tmp -d -7 -c "cmd /c del path"
:删除7天前的临时文件
move important.doc D:Backup & del /q important.doc
八、风险控制与数据恢复
8. 误删防护体系
防护层级 | 技术手段 | 恢复概率 |
---|---|---|
操作前备份 | xcopy /s /h /k C:Data D:Backup | 100%(完整镜像) |
回收站机制 | 启用Recycle 服务并配置策略 | 取决于回收站设置 |
文件历史记录
相关文章
Windows 8系统作为微软经典操作系统之一,其开机密码设置功能在保障用户隐私和系统安全方面具有重要作用。相较于早期版本,Win8通过多维度的安全机制实现了密码保护,既支持传统本地账户的密码设置,也兼容微软账户的云端管理。系统提供了至少三
2025-05-09 07:18:34
![]()
系统U盘作为正版Windows 11的便携载体,在系统部署、数据备份及多设备适配场景中扮演重要角色。其核心优势在于通过官方渠道获取的纯净镜像与自动化安装流程,既能保障系统安全性,又能提升部署效率。相较于传统光盘或网络安装,U盘介质具备即插即
2025-05-09 07:17:59
![]()
Win7屏幕模糊问题主要源于显示设置、分辨率匹配度、字体渲染机制及硬件兼容性等多方面因素。该现象可能由驱动程序版本过低导致图像渲染异常,或未正确匹配显示器原生分辨率造成像素拉伸。此外,Windows Aero主题的透明特效与字体平滑功能(C
2025-05-09 07:17:47
![]()
Windows 7作为微软经典操作系统,其自带的Windows Defender杀毒软件虽不如新一代系统版本功能完善,但仍为早期用户提供基础防护。该程序默认处于禁用状态,需通过手动配置激活。本文将从八个维度深入解析其启用方法与功能特性,结合
2025-05-09 07:17:46
![]()
Windows 10的自动更新机制旨在保障系统安全性与稳定性,但其强制更新特性可能干扰用户工作安排或占用网络资源。取消自动更新需权衡系统安全与自主控制权,核心矛盾在于微软通过多种通道(如Windows Update服务、UsoSvc组件、背
2025-05-09 07:17:19
![]()
Windows 11作为新一代操作系统,其安全模式启动机制在继承经典功能的同时,针对硬件兼容性、驱动隔离和系统保护进行了多项优化。相较于Windows 10,Win11进一步简化了安全模式的进入流程,但同时也引入了对TPM和Secure B
2025-05-09 07:16:39
![]()
热门推荐
资讯中心:
|